Bromoenol lactone
Bromoenol lactone (CAS 88070-98-8), with the molecular formula C16H13BrO2 and a molecular weight of 317.18 g/mol, is a specialized organic compound. It is recognised for its utility as a biochemical reagent and in cell biology research. The compound is primarily employed as an inhibitor, particularly in studies related to enzyme mechanisms and cell signaling pathways. Enzyme Inhibition Studies
Bromoenol lactone serves as a valuable tool for researchers investigating enzyme kinetics and mechanisms. Its inhibitory properties can be leveraged to understand the function of specific enzymes, particularly within cellular processes.
Cell Biology Research
This compound is utilized in cell biology to explore various cellular functions and signaling pathways. Its application aids in dissecting complex biological processes at the molecular level.
Biochemical Investigations
As a biochemical reagent, Bromoenol lactone is employed in a range of laboratory investigations. It contributes to the understanding of lipid metabolism and cell signaling, particularly concerning phospholipase activity.
| Molecular weight | 317.18 |
|---|---|
| Empirical formula | C16H13BrO2 |
| Assay | ≥98% |
| Solubility | DMSO: soluble (Dilute in aqueous medium immediately prior to use and store on ice for no more than 12 hours.)degassed ethanol: soluble (Dilute in aqueous medium immediately prior to use and store on ice for no more than 12 hours.) |
| Storage temperature | −20°C |
